Alaros Exploration Total Long-Term Assets Calculation

Total Long-Term Assets are the sum of the carrying amounts of all assets that are expected to be realized in cash, sold or consumed longer than one year. It includes Investments And Advances, Intangible Assets, Property, Plant and Equipment and Other Long Term Assets.

Alaros Exploration Business Description

Alaros Exploration Inc is currently engaged in the acquisition, exploration and development of mineral properties. The Company holds the exclusive option to acquire a 100% interest in the Birk Creek Property (the Property), which is subject to a 3% net smelter returns royalty. The Property is located in southern British Columbia, approximately 82 km north-northeast of Kamloops, in the Kamloops Mining Division. The Property is situated within the traditional territory of the Secwepemc First Nation.
